Protests mark V-Day

Vladimir Radyuhin

MOSCOW: Thousands of Communist supporters took to the streets in Moscow on Tuesday to mark the 61st anniversary of victory in World War Two and protest against the social policies of the Government. Over 10,000 Communists-led demonstrators waving red flags and raising anti-government slogans marched through the central part of Moscow in an impressive display of opposition strength. Some demonstrators carried portraits of Joseph Stalin and Vladimir Lenin, and placards saying "We'll rebuild the Soviet Union", "We'll defend our Victory," and "Down with Putin." The Opposition manifestation took place shortly after a traditional military parade in Red Square attended by President Vladimir Putin and members of the Russian Government. Speaking on the occasion Mr. Putin warned against a resurging threat of fascism today. However, Communist leader Gennaday Zyuganov said authorities were sticking the label of "fascists" on all left-wing Opposition.
